SPRING DISTRICT NETWORK DAY
The spring District Network Day was held recently on Thursday 25 March at Thurlby in the Bourne Circuit. Attendance was down on last year but those of us who were there enjoyed a relaxing day in the company of our Thurlby hosts and guest speaker, Judith Lampard who chose as her theme, ‘Sacred Places and Holy People’. Judith began with her ‘home chapel’ in Dove Holes, Derbyshire and took us on a journey through places, time and space where it was possible to reflect on and enhance our spiritual experience.
For myself, it was a nostalgic trip back to the circuit where I had previously spent 14 years; indeed, I would include Bourne and Thurlby Methodist churches in my list of sacred places as I spent so many happy times in both places, some of which I shared during the morning session.
During the short business meeting, information was shared regarding the future of network and the World Federation of Methodist and Uniting Church Women, soon to become ‘Methodist Women in Britain’.
We could not have managed without the sterling efforts of Trevor and Val Peacock who provided music and sound support.
SWANWICK CONFERENCE, 16 – 18 APRIL
This year’s conference was the first joint venture by both Network and the World Federation, attended by 170 ladies including just 2 from L&G District, Iris West and myself. As always, it was good to catch up with friends ‘old and new’ and to make new friends in the various groups and creative options.
The theme was ‘Moving and Travelling on’ in which the main sessions were a series of Bible studies and discussion based on the experiences of Mary and Elizabeth, with a Russian emphasis as Nicola Vidamour (main facilitator) had recently returned from ministry there.
Early morning prayers were available to suit many preferred styles and Alison Judd’s sharing of reflections on Rublev’s Icon of the Trinity was the highlight of the weekend for me. (Alison will be the guest speaker at the Autumn District Day on 6 October at Ashby Wesley in Scunthorpe).
The beautiful warm enhanced the relaxed atmosphere of the weekend and meant it was possible to really enjoy the grounds and setting of this well equipped conference centre.
Sue Leese, District Network President
